Choosing a Home Theater Design Idea


Home theater systems are becoming less and less expensive every year, and more affordable to the average consumer. If you have the room for a home theater, it can definitely be worth the time and expense involved.

Having a home theater system is different from having a nice TV with surround sound speakers and a DVD player. It involves quite a bit more than that, especially in terms of equipment. A true home theater system will have a room dedicated to that one use.

Requirements For a Home Theater System

The biggest when choosing a home theater design idea is the function of your TV. Experts say that a TV about six feet wide is a good size for a home theater. From this alone, you can infer how large of a room you are going to need for your home theater design idea. Of course, this home theater design idea along with the size of your TV is dictated by the size of your room. If your room is smaller, you will definitely need a smaller TV.

Another major component of a home theater design idea is surround sound and amplification. A home theater design idea will need space for at least five full-range speakers and a subwoofer, along with amplifier to enhance the sound quality. Many manufacturers integrate all of this technology into a single item so it is easier for the consumer to find the right items.

When considering your home theater design idea, you will have to take into account the new wiring for the system. You will need to think about all of your components and how they work together, and work out your wiring from there. Sometimes you may have to put an extra breaker in your breaker box to handle all of the extra equipment, but that is not that hard to deal with.

Lastly, you will need a DVD player, a VCR if you still have tapes, and you can even hook up a digital video record such as a TiVo to watch television shows on. If you do not already have these things, you will want to do some research on these as well, and make sure they can integrate well into your new system.

Any type of home theater design idea will be customized to the family planning it. Do your research on the equipment and everything else you will need and find the supplies that work well for your family and especially the room everything will go in.
